Mig Welder - 1st shift
**Position Summary:** The Welder I is responsible for assembly, tack and Mig welding of iso-bend pipe, fittings, and special products to engineering and customer supplied specifications. **Principle Duties (includes, but is not limited to):** + Visually inspect all components prior to assembly for compliance to work order specifications, and for burrs, defects, and cleanliness. + Calculate the cut length of iso-bend pipe to achieve the correct finish length and mark the cut-off points. + Secure iso-bend pipe and cut to length with pipe cutting tool. + Set-up pipes sever machine and cut pipe to length without cutting the liner. + Install the correct flange/stub end combination and weld pipe housing in accordance with manufacturing and customer supplied specifications. + Recheck overall spool length with allowance for liner thickness and complete the inspection sheet. + Assemble and tack weld fitting and special products using a press or other appropriate tooling. + Weld fittings and special products complete in accordance with manufacturing and customer supplied specifications. + Perform all welding in the position as specified by the Procedure and welder qualification. + Set-up welders with correct filler wire and compressed gas at the proper pressure setting. + When required, assemble, tack and tig weld fittings in accordance with manufacturing procedures. + Use blueprint reading skills to interpret engineering or customer supplied drawings and specifications. + Use ability to read measuring instruments not limited to, but including tape measure, micrometers, and calipers. + Verify protective shield and restricted area signs are in place before welding. + Perform material handling functions using hand trucks and carts. **Essential Qualifications / Experience:** + High School Diploma, GED, or equivalent. + Must be able to lift parts weighing up to 50 lbs without assistance, any parts weighing over 50lbs requires a team lift. + Fabrication experience and the ability to work from blueprints and sketches. + Must pass Crane welding qualifications test, which includes a plate test (fillit welds) on an 8-inch coupon, schedule 40 pipe, open root, 3 passes (root downhill, hot pass uphill, cover pass uphill, and must pass X-ray requirements. **Preferred Qualifications / Experience:** + Five or more years welding experience in a manufacturing environment. + ASME Section IX MIG certification or be able to obtain certification within a reasonable period. + Three or more years’ experience with carbon steel. _This description has been designed to indicate the general nature and level of work being performed by employees within this classification.
